Construction et configuration d'applications réparties / Luc Bellissard ; sous la direction de Michel Riveill

Date :

Format : 1 vol. (152 p.)

Type : Livre / Book

Type : Thèse / Thesis

Langue / Language : français / French

Riveill, Michel (1960-.... ; auteur en informatique) (Directeur de thèse / thesis advisor)

Institut national polytechnique (Grenoble, Isère, France ; 1900-....) (Organisme de soutenance / degree-grantor)

Ecole nationale supérieure d'informatique et de mathématiques appliquées (Grenoble, Isère, France ; 1970-....) (Autre partenaire associé à la thèse / thesis associated third party)

Equipe-projet Systèmes informatiques répartis pour applications coopératives (Montbonnot, Isère ; 1996-2001) (Equipe de recherche associée à la thèse / thesis associated research team)

Relation : Construction et configuration d'applications réparties / Luc Bellissard / Villeurbanne : [CCSD] , 2004

Relation : Construction et configuration d'applications réparties / Luc Bellissard ; sous la direction de Michel Riveill / Grenoble : Atelier national de reproduction des thèses , 1997

Résumé / Abstract : L'objectif de cette thèse est d'étudier les modèles de construction et de configuration d'applications réparties. La configuration d'une application correspond à la fois à l'identification de l'architecture logicielle et à son adaptation aux ressources disponibles dans un environnement réparti pour produire une image exécutable de l'application. Le résultat de ce travail est en premier lieu le langage de configuration Olan (OCL) qui apporte des solutions aux problèmes de définition de l'architecture d'une application, d'intégration de logiciels existants hétérogènes, d'adaptation aux facteurs de répartition, notamment aux ressources et mécanismes répartis disponibles, et enfin à la génération de l'image exécutable. En second lieu, ce travail propose un support système permettant d'installer et de déployer l'applications selon les directives et contraintes spécifiées au travers de l'architecture

Résumé / Abstract : This work aims at studying various models for the engineering and the configuration of distributed applications. The word configuration refers here to both the identification of the software architecture, in terms of software components and communication requirements, as well as the adaptation to the available resources and the underlying constraints of the targeted distributed environment. The result of this work is at first the definition of the Olan Configuration Language (OCL) which major contributions are a mean of highlighting the application architecture, focusing on some aspects of the application dynamic behavior, a solution to the integration of heterogeneous legacy software, the configuration of the application related to the distribution concerns, such as the available resources or remote communication mechanisms. All this contribution finally aims at generating the executable image of the application. In a second hand, this work has also defined a system support that enables the remote installation and deployment of an application architecture according to the OCL specification onto a heterogeneous distributed environment